Hiring for Senior Application Developer in Philadelphia, PA

10 Nov 2024

Vacancy expired!

Role: Senior Application Developer Location: Philadelphia, PA Duration: Long Term Job purpose: The Senior Application Developer will deliver technical solutions for a Provider Engagement web portal application that allow area health-care providers to connect and interact with Independence Family of Companies in order to transact business electronically. This position will work closely with various solution development and infrastructure teams across the Independence FOC, such as application development teams, DevOps team, and System Administrators. The Developer will work with business partners to understand business needs and to translate the specific requirements into technical solutions. The Developer will develop, maintain, and administer Liferay-based web portal solutions, customizations to the core Liferay product, and Spring Java APIs that enable business functionality. Front-end development experience is a plus. The Developer is expected to bring the business requirement from a conceptual design to a technical solution through all phases of the software lifecycle: technical design, development, unit test, functional test support, and production implementation. Active participation in daily scrums within the Agile framework is expected. Job description/main accountabilities:

  • Develop software solutions which support the business data requirements.
  • Set up and maintain configuration and development platform for Liferay portal solutions.
  • Manage growth and scale of web server farm. Plan capacity and load test for anticipated need.
  • Interact with Liferay product support team to address functional defects and system vulnerabilities.
  • Define and document the technical requirements within Azure DevOps.
  • Ensure compliance with security practices within the DevOps process.
  • Participate in on-call support duties and daily scrum meetings.
  • Develop architecture diagrams appropriate for the application.
  • Conduct and participate in technical architecture reviews to validate the solution's conformance to customer and systems requirements
  • Work with Application Architects and Database Administrators to enable full-stack solutions that integrate front-end content management systems and applications and backend database systems or APIs.
  • Develop web pages within the Liferay framework.
  • Develop web pages within the Angular framework.
  • Develop and maintain RESTful APIs.
  • Produce system documentation including technical requirements, user stories, architecture diagrams.
  • Support application testing and production implementation as required
  • Assist in the development of the coding standards.
  • Assist other team members
  • Stay current with industry content management system best practices and standards
  • Conduct peer reviews
  • Work with Customer teams to gain a solid understanding of the business rules and systems that integrate with Portal technologies.
  • Performs other duties as assigned
Education/Experience:
  • Bachelor's Degree or equivalent experience in a technology related field or equivalent work experience.
  • 6+ years of proven experience in Java development, web and portal technologies, content management systems, or distributed systems integration.
  • Highly skilled in enterprise Java / Java EE technologies, Servlets/JSP, Spring and Hibernate.
  • Knowledgeable in web interface technologies: HTML, JavaScript, Angular, SAML, REST API, SOAP, and XML technologies.
  • Solid knowledge of Windows and Linux OS, JBOSS AS, Apache Tomcat, LDAP, and Azure Active Directory.
  • Advanced understanding and experience in Java and OO design.
  • Ability to work within an Agile Methodology and according to the DevOps process using Jenkins, Maven, BitBucket, Git, and JUNIT.
  • Expert knowledge of database systems, including Oracle, SQL Server, and MySQL. Fluency in SQL query techniques.
  • Experience with Liferay upgrades preferred.
  • Ability to improve application performance and identify performance tuning opportunities.
  • Demonstrate analytical and problem-solving skills.
  • Ability to define deliverables, tasks, and dependencies for multiple work streams.
  • Adhere to enterprise application architecture policies and standards.
  • Adhere to enterprise security standards and practices.
  • Strong team player, excellent oral and written communication skills.
  • Ability to communicate effectively with both business and technical teams.
  • Fast starter, effectively deliver with limited supervision. Ability to work under pressure and meet aggressive deadlines.
  • Experience with facilitating requirements and/or design meetings.
  • Good organizational and technical writing skills, including creation of Functional Specifications, Process Models, Use Cases, Functional Diagram Business Requirements.
  • Ability to multi-task with several concurrent issues and projects.
  • Strong interpersonal, written, and verbal communication skills
  • Healthcare payer knowledge preferred.
  • Liferay certification preferred.
Thanks & Regards Suraj Prasad Technical Recruiter Siri InfoSolutions Inc. Phone: Email ID: Visit us at: www.siriinfo.com

  • ID: #22491355
  • State: Pennsylvania Philadelphia 19130 Philadelphia USA
  • City: Philadelphia
  • Salary: USD TBD TBD
  • Job type: Contract
  • Showed: 2021-11-10
  • Deadline: 2022-01-09
  • Category: Healthcare